{"id":732,"date":"2020-03-12T18:21:59","date_gmt":"2020-03-12T17:21:59","guid":{"rendered":"https:\/\/blog.mhasin.eu\/?p=732"},"modified":"2020-03-13T12:27:58","modified_gmt":"2020-03-13T11:27:58","slug":"apache2-povolenie-http-2","status":"publish","type":"post","link":"https:\/\/blog.mhasin.eu\/?p=732","title":{"rendered":"Apache2 povolenie HTTP\/2"},"content":{"rendered":"\n<p class=\"wp-block-paragraph\">Intalacia HTTP\/2 protokolu v apache2. <\/p>\n\n\n\n<figure class=\"wp-block-image size-large is-style-zoooom\"><img loading=\"lazy\" decoding=\"async\" width=\"838\" height=\"418\" src=\"https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-18.png\" alt=\"\" class=\"wp-image-737\" srcset=\"https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-18.png 838w, https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-18-300x150.png 300w, https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-18-768x383.png 768w\" sizes=\"auto, (max-width: 838px) 100vw, 838px\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\"> Pre pdoporu ttp je potrebne nainstalovat (debian 10): <\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>sudo apt-get install php7.3-fpm\nsudo a2dismod php7.3\nsudo a2enconf php7.3-fpm\nsudo a2enmod proxy_fcgi<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Zak\u00e1zanie mpm_prefork<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>a2dismod mpm_prefork<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Povolenie mpm_event<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>a2enmod mpm_event<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Povolenie http2<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>a2enmod ssl\na2enmod http2<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Resrt http servera:<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>systemctl restart apache2<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Povolenie http2 potokolu v kofiguracii https virtualhosta webserveru apache2:<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>nano \/etc\/apache2\/sites-enabled\/blog.mhasin.eu-le-ssl.conf<\/code><\/pre>\n\n\n\n<pre class=\"wp-block-code\"><code><VirtualHost *:443>\n  ServerName example.com\n  ServerAlias www.example.com\n  DocumentRoot \/var\/www\/public_html\/example.com\n  SSLEngine on\n  SSLCertificateKeyFile \/path\/to\/private.pem\n  SSLCertificateFile \/path\/to\/cert.pem\n  SSLProtocol all -SSLv3 -TLSv1 -TLSv1.1\n  Protocols h2 http\/1.1\n<\/VirtualHost><\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Do konfiguracie je potrebne pridat nastavenie: <\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>  Protocols h2 http\/1.1<\/code><\/pre>\n\n\n\n<p class=\"wp-block-paragraph\">Preferovan\u00fd protokol bude HTTP\/2 ak klient tento protokol nepodporuje tak prejde na protokol HTTP\/1.1<\/p>\n\n\n\n<p class=\"wp-block-paragraph\">Kontrola aktu\u00e1lneho protokolu http serveru:<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code> curl -I https:\/\/blog.mhasin.eu<\/code><\/pre>\n\n\n\n<figure class=\"wp-block-image size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"651\" height=\"126\" src=\"https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-17.png\" alt=\"\" class=\"wp-image-734\" srcset=\"https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-17.png 651w, https:\/\/blog.mhasin.eu\/wp-content\/uploads\/2020\/03\/obr\u00e1zok-17-300x58.png 300w\" sizes=\"auto, (max-width: 651px) 100vw, 651px\" \/><\/figure>\n\n\n\n<p class=\"wp-block-paragraph\">Web test:<\/p>\n\n\n\n<pre class=\"wp-block-code\"><code>https:\/\/tools.keycdn.com\/http2-test<\/code><\/pre>\n<div class=\"pdf24Plugin-cp\"> \t<form name=\"pdf24Form0\" method=\"post\" action=\"https:\/\/doc2pdf.pdf24.org\/wordpress.php\" target=\"pdf24PopWin\" onsubmit=\"var pdf24Win = window.open('about:blank', 'pdf24PopWin', 'resizable=yes,scrollbars=yes,width=600,height=250,left='+(screen.width\/2-300)+',top='+(screen.height\/3-125)+''); pdf24Win.focus(); if(typeof pdf24OnCreatePDF === 'function'){void(pdf24OnCreatePDF(this,pdf24Win));}\"> \t\t<input type=\"hidden\" name=\"blogCharset\" value=\"Cw1x07UAAA==\" \/><input type=\"hidden\" name=\"blogPosts\" value=\"MwQA\" \/><input type=\"hidden\" name=\"blogUrl\" value=\"yygpKSi20tdPyslP18vNSCzOzNNLLQUA\" \/><input type=\"hidden\" name=\"blogName\" value=\"c\/LxdwcA\" \/><input type=\"hidden\" name=\"blogValueEncoding\" value=\"gzdeflate base64\" \/><input type=\"hidden\" name=\"postId_0\" value=\"Mzc2AgA=\" \/><input type=\"hidden\" name=\"postTitle_0\" value=\"cyxITM5INVIoyC\/Lz0nNy0xV8AgJCdA3AgA=\" \/><input type=\"hidden\" name=\"postLink_0\" value=\"yygpKSi20tdPyslP18vNSCzOzNNLLdW3L7A1NzYCAA==\" \/><input type=\"hidden\" name=\"postAuthor_0\" value=\"y00syfcwNAIA\" \/><input type=\"hidden\" name=\"postDateTime_0\" value=\"MzIwMtA1MNY1NFIwtLAyMLYytQQA\" \/><input type=\"hidden\" name=\"postContent_0\" value=\"rVZfb9s2EH\/3pzjoYWiHSvSfJDYy28CwbmjRYgiaYAP2EtDSWWJNkQRJyXa+TT\/InvLFdqLs2G7S1l6iF4ni8X6\/O\/54vM7YQCq5c5NoaeKZ1OkiNtzy3HJTRNP3ynPJU8Hh3c3NFeuDsdrrhZYV1MANTwvsJzBmZtqhZzwXeWXxkUNR8hzBiTuMJbf0KVzs\/FpifKfpKaPpWJQ5SM0zofJJJPndOoIMU92OuVurNIKlyHwxiUaDUQQFirzwk+isRwNn00lUeG\/cJWMEmSdlwZ1QCVaMSKRaeVSeVaZBcKzf7XdZd8D0zN5\/udOLuDdKjMoj4JI8Rnv0A\/F4OBgGDIf+BWCA+C\/fwLP8xINud9U77wZ\/9P1sf8OL0WowGgR\/9L2Mwm5REnjl9Rt4VfJVHNJ\/2dA3q9fQ63Zrgg2jCNh0zNrNb4XwXVHBFWnEZNpoWwHRhs801N7iTCEoLpQj0emae3iV4UxwRWCvL3cqM09IjKSCJKPmNXVVpkmcPs7RQ+tNginMMBnEc1N22vl+Jlyps83E9icqStf8CWtUwdjq1fp2nuZizAIWkToq5n\/4gpLNlUAoTXlLi+baLo4O6YHtweKTGFzpWkvcEsCaJHECfBv+3sr\/id3ItH8yrnOys\/3eeDgJ\/xM668NKcGhrtPzyeDWtnccy9RIskpTIz6buPS8HjeK3hXShw9mhOivacwy1sL7istCECEuctayrLfTx7BVXGhj6lG2WMic8uhgVn0nMvioXMZVkynXSnIEnwvsB1k\/S\/\/JXS\/wdEYefL8\/OBtMOwHVg\/ycvEXDFSyOREMqHiV+l4A6Wy2VyOPtWp1VJYvuktQdWc8vIhplqJkV6W\/hSsq+8XX\/8XeWCiohW7fA3tF7MRco9fsD1H0IiMMN9wbymsASVGEwMlo+MDy1TmtiZXTU3YKolNFUlph\/1AOKbj9d1b\/NKemS4tXJQ9MOesuZ\/kyG2l6LpiRp6q0kraisWPCicFE9GJVNxkkzd6OyEivkNvqcqnOoSWirc6v7fh0YBZlWG2+6BL2AhBW0pNDeS3hkpNDpr7gOKyJMVAX7OmstgZxJcBFLmCC4f6NKzWnKC9NX9F6mw0HvNy14pqI4\/TJBWlvb8\/Tcu28fpOrIfOq3\/uTjv7fqfXv\/iBfqf4Q\/6n7OX6X8CDBD\/Z\/Yrw9D\/nI8e2p\/vtCuEtteuhNGJ7crfOCO5On+8TraxeU0HKlngOs1UU6NYqPxx4+xQK\/8B\" \/> \t\t<a href=\"https:\/\/www.pdf24.org\" target=\"_blank\" title=\"www.pdf24.org\" rel=\"nofollow\"><img src=\"https:\/\/blog.mhasin.eu\/wp-content\/plugins\/pdf24-post-to-pdf\/img\/pdf_32x32.png\" alt=\"\" border=\"0\" height=\"32\" \/><\/a> \t\t<span class=\"pdf24Plugin-cp-space\">\u00a0\u00a0<\/span> \t\t<span class=\"pdf24Plugin-cp-text\">Send article as PDF<\/span> \t\t<span class=\"pdf24Plugin-cp-space\">\u00a0\u00a0<\/span> \t\t<input class=\"pdf24Plugin-cp-input\" style=\"margin: 0px;\" type=\"text\" name=\"sendEmailTo\" placeholder=\"Enter email address\" \/> \t\t<input class=\"pdf24Plugin-cp-submit\" style=\"margin: 0px;\" type=\"submit\" value=\"Send\" \/> \t<\/form> <\/div>","protected":false},"excerpt":{"rendered":"Intalacia HTTP\/2 protokolu v apache2. Pre pdoporu ttp je potrebne nainstalovat (debian 10): Zak\u00e1zanie mpm_prefork Povolenie mpm_event Povolenie http2 Resrt http servera: Povolenie http2 potokolu v kofiguracii https virtualhosta webserveru apache2: Do konfiguracie je potrebne pridat nastavenie: Preferovan\u00fd protokol bude HTTP\/2 ak klient tento protokol nepodporuje tak prejde na protokol HTTP\/1.1 Kontrola aktu\u00e1lneho protokolu http serveru: Web test: \u00a0\u00a0 Send article as PDF \u00a0\u00a0\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"arc_restricted_post":false,"footnotes":""},"categories":[4],"tags":[],"class_list":["post-732","post","type-post","status-publish","format-standard","hentry","category-linux"],"_links":{"self":[{"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/posts\/732","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=732"}],"version-history":[{"count":4,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/posts\/732\/revisions"}],"predecessor-version":[{"id":738,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=\/wp\/v2\/posts\/732\/revisions\/738"}],"wp:attachment":[{"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=732"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=732"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.mhasin.eu\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=732"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}